Transaction ff8d7c6644562f2003ecc28435e6302fac48d50ec2a026220763fe292ea68ccf
1 Input
1 Output
-
ff8d7c6644562f2003ecc28435e6302fac48d50ec2a026220763fe292ea68ccf:0
- value
- 308250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50fead39bc4315ca4cf31b86c6faf2dc65d9d7c9 OP_EQUAL
- address
- 395H58n3h9vWwV6fSF5LRJDxxhFgv32wxH